Textile & Apparel Studies is the 158th most popular major in the country with 3,436 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, textile and apparel studies gra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$33,403 and had an average of $23,866 in loans still to pay off.
Across North Carolina, there were 170 textile and apparel studies graduates with average earnings and debt of $30,550 and $25,013 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 10 textile and apparel studies graduates with average earnings and debt of $55,088 and $45,388 respectively.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of North Carolina at Greensboro. The school came in at #1 for the Best Vallue Textile Studies Schools for a Master’s in North Carolina For Those Making Over $110k. This fairly large school is located in Greensboro, North Carolina, and it awarded 10 masters’s textile studies degrees in 2019-2020.
As a testament to the quality of education offered at UNC Greensboro, the school also landed the #1 spot in our “Best Textile & Apparel Studies Master’s Degree Schools in North Carolina”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at UNC Greensboro are $21,918, but some majors have different tuition rates.
